Right Wingnuts Hand Democrats Another Congressional Seat

The Right Wingnuts led by Rush Limbaugh, Sarah Palin, Glenn Beck and Michelle Malkin lost their election in the 23rd Congressional District of New York as the ultra-conservative Republican candidate Doug Hoffman conceded to Democrat Bill Owens.

Owens gained 49 percent of the vote, versus 46 percent for Hoffman, and six percent for Dede Scozzafava, whose name was still on the ballot, even though she dropped out of the race.

This race saw the original Republican challenger Dede Scozzafava back out of the race under extreme pressure from within her own party and the Right Wingnut fringe. They - led by media pundits Rush Limbaugh, Sarah Palin, Glenn Beck and Michelle Malkin - hand picked Doug Hoffman as the man who would save them. With their withering communications drumbeat, Hoffman rose from nowhere in the polls to the point of being considered the front runner before tonight's election.

Had the Right-Wingnuts stayed out of the race and allowed Scozzafava to run her campaign, the GOP would doubtlessly have kept this seat, which had voted consistently Republican since the days of Ulysses S. Grant. Now, however, the Democrats have won five consecutive special Congressional elections.
